Common signs include peeling paint, musty odors, warped floorboards, ceiling discoloration, and unexplained spikes in your water bill. If you notice any of these, contact us for a professional moisture inspection.

Typically, it takes 3 to 5 days to completely dry structural materials like drywall and framing, but this depends heavily on the extent of saturation and materials involved.
